Successful breakthrough in drive technology

Parker directional control valves can optimize high-end hydraulic systems and standard applications at minimum initial and maintenance costs, and the patented Voice Coil Drive VCD matches servo valves in its high level of performance.

The VCD technology represents a successful breakthrough in the drive technology for proportional directional control valves: unlike in standard proportional solenoid drives, Voice Coil Drive actuates the spool by using a movable coil over a fixed permanent magnet. The coil is mechanically connected with the spool, and the friction-free actuator system actively moves the spool to the required position. Movement direction depends on the given current direction, and a high-resolution feedback system sends back the actual position. If a power failure occurs, a spring moves the spool to a defined position.

Among the advantages and highlights of these valves from Wainbee:

  • No active return spring required;
  • Low moved masses by high force density;
  • No additional bearing in actuator;
  • Real servo-valve dynamics that ensure optimized cycle times, ideal for demanding applications;
  • Very good repeatability, with better process and product accuracy;
  • Robust valve design, for minimal failure;
  • Digital electronics that users can easily adapt to specific applications, resulting in more flexibility;
  • Short delivery time, with no storage required;
  • Defined spool positioning and power-down;
  • Optional EtherCAT interface, for high data speeds and short cycle times; and
  • Optional freely configurable supervising control circuit.

These proportional directional control valves also offer more efficiency, with enhanced process and product accuracy through high-precision production and higher machine output due to shorter cycle times. Lower costs result from reduced downtime through the robust design and short delivery times.
